Description

Whether you're taking on a northeastern winter or you're taking on Mount Lincoln's Sugar Bowl, the Mountain Hardwear Men's Downtown Coat will keep you in insulated warmth and comfort for the duration. Waterproof and breathable, this rugged down coat keeps you warm and dry wherever you need protection from the cold.

Built with DryQ Core construction, this durable jacket has been fully taped for complete waterproof protection and features a breathable membrane that lets body heat and perspiration escape, for all day dryness and comfort. The exterior fabric is abrasion resistant and has a DWR (Durable Water Repellent) finish for added element shedding performance. Insulated with 650-fill goose down, this sleek jacket provides high-loft warmth that's easily compressible and still sports a streamlined, urban fit without added weight or bulk. With a removable hood for added coverage when you need it and a Micro-Chamois™ lined chin guard that never chafes, this winter shell can handle any winter weather on the horizon. From city streets to mountain exploits, the Mountain Hardwear Downtown Coat for men goes anywhere.

Specifications

  • Fabric: Ascent Micro Herringbone AXF™
  • Insulation: 650-fill goose down
  • Waterproof / breathable: 10000 mm / 10000 g/m²
  • Laminate: DryQ Core is 100% durably waterproof and breathable
  • AXF Super DWR (Durable Water Repellent) finish repels water 5 times longer than standard DWRs
  • Fully taped and waterproof
  • Zip-off hood
  • Micro-Chamois™ lined chin guard
  • Rib knit collar and cuffs
  • Fleece-lined hand pockets
  • Interior MP3 pocket with earpiece cord exit
  • Interior zip pocket
  • Center back length: 35 in, 89 cm
  • Weight: 2 lb 11 oz, 1.22 kg

I love this coat After moving to the Windy City of Chicago, I needed a down parka that would be both comfortable and stylish. This coat completely fits the bill, and provides excellent warmth. The insulated hood is highly functional, as are the fleece lined pockets. My only complaint is that there aren't quite enough pockets to satisfy me - just 2 hand pockets and 1 left chest pocket, with no extra pockets on the inside of the coat. But the coat also looks GREAT - I can wear it with business casual or formal attire. It looks more like a coat than any other winter jacket I've owned. Also, regarding my pockets comment, the minimal number of external pockets definitely helps the style and look of the coat. I can tell that the coat is high quality, and it has stood up to the elements during Chicago winter. The fit is also wonderful - I'm 5'8", 165, medium build, and the Medium fits me perfectly.
